Transaction 95fc59c505ffc9c1bd7381636ecbfca8dbac6889de7052fe14ed3d53898f0c6a
1 Input
1 Output
-
95fc59c505ffc9c1bd7381636ecbfca8dbac6889de7052fe14ed3d53898f0c6a:0
- value
- 11367463
- script pubkey
- OP_0 OP_PUSHBYTES_20 48af89e619263980c5dd0afe801e30fae7507025
- address
- bc1qfzhcneseycucp3waptlgq83sltn4qup95kv25g